Re: Why do I have a no when it was just the buyer thanking me for something I did for her???

Jump to solution

Hey There!

 

The Message response rate counts initial messages from all Etsy members, both buyers, and other sellers. This also includes duplicate messages or messages sent in error. Unwanted messages may be marked as spam.

 

You can set up an auto-reply to make sure all new messages will have a reply. You can learn more about it here.

 

This month of July, we introduced a new-and-improved Messages experience that will start to combine messages from the same buyer into a single thread. You can learn more about this and some other exciting changes here.

Re: Why do I have a no when it was just the buyer thanking me for something I did for her???

Jump to solution

Etsy can't read every convo sent and try to figure out what it might mean and if it needs a reply.  It's impossible.  

The only thing they look at is if it's the first message and if you reply.  

Make sure to read the rules if you want to get/keep the badge.

Re: Why do I have a no when it was just the buyer thanking me for something I did for her???

Jump to solution

You have to answer or spam all first messages. Spam it now and it may come off your score in a couple days. I'd do it quickly as month end is approaching.
